Village officials also argued he lacked the licenses required to operate a camp serving about 60 children.
Decision pending: Dolton officials will decide whether to reinstate or revoke the facility's business license, while the Dolton Police Department continues its investigation into the incidents.
New details in Dolton summer camp shut downThe backstory:Because minors were involved, cameras were not permitted inside Thursday's hearing.
During the hearing, Village Attorney Michael McGrath argued the building was approved to operate as a fitness center, not as a summer camp or daycare.
Dig deeper:He testified that the free summer camp served about 60 children and was staffed by four full-time employees and six part-time workers.
